Weekender at Paul Smith's College 2026

FRI, July 31, 2026 · Paul Smiths , United States

About this race

The Weekender at Paul Smith's College is a three-day cycling trip held on the college's 14,000-acre lakeside campus in the Saranac Lake region of the Adirondacks. This is a supported, family-friendly event offering rides at multiple distances, allowing participants to select their daily mileage. Riders may stay in campus dorms or arrange nearby lodging, and an optional campus meal plan simplifies logistics for groups. The rides start from campus and incorporate sections of the Adirondack Rail Trail, including car-free portions. Beyond cycling, activities include paddling on nearby ponds, hiking, walking forest boardwalks, and evening campfires. It is designed for friends and families seeking a relaxed cycling trip with straightforward navigation and ample free time to explore Paul Smith's and Saranac Lake.
